Beyond the Product: Using AI to Assess the Learning Process
2:00PM | Breakout Session 4 | Teaching/Learning Track
This session delves into how AI can revolutionize assessment by focusing not just on the final product (e.g., essays, exams), but also on the learning process. Participants will explore the innovative SPACE framework developed by Stanford University, designed for the age of AI-assisted writing. The session will provide practical strategies for using AI to enhance the learning process and cultivate critical thinking and communication skills.

Presenter: Erin Sailor
Erin began her career as a Teach for America corps member in an integrated co-teaching setting as a special education teacher and reading interventionist in the classroom. During her time as a tenured teacher leader in New York City, Erin developed school-wide curriculums, facilitated and monitored the effectiveness of professional development, and was named a Model Teacher by the NYCDOE. Scaling her passion for equitable education with Eduscape, she collaborates daily to provide teachers and students with the experiences and resources they need. Erin holds a BS in history and sociology from Loyola University, Maryland, an MA in special education from Fordham University, as well as holds certifications as a SCRUM project manager, Google Educator, Microsoft Innovative Educator, and ISTE Certified Educator.
